高性价比
国外便宜VPS服务器推荐

在阿里云服务器上搭建Vue项目

高效部署Vue项目于阿里云服务器的最佳实践

Vue.js 是一种现代化的前端框架,以其轻量级和易用性广受开发者的欢迎。为了确保 Vue 应用程序能够稳定运行并提供卓越的用户体验,将项目部署到可靠的服务器至关重要。阿里云作为全球领先的云计算服务提供商,为开发者提供了多样化的解决方案。本文将深入探讨如何在阿里云服务器上成功部署 Vue 项目。

准备工作

在开始部署之前,确保完成以下准备工作:

  • 安装并配置好 Node.js 和 npm 环境,这是 Vue 项目的运行基础。
  • 准备好 Vue 项目代码,并确保本地环境已通过构建命令生成生产版本文件。
  • 注册并登录阿里云账户,创建所需的云服务器实例。

选择适合的服务器配置

在部署 Vue 项目前,合理选择服务器配置是关键步骤之一。建议根据项目的规模与预期访问量来决定资源配置:

  • 选择合适的操作系统,例如 Ubuntu 或 CentOS,以支持 Node.js 的正常运行。
  • 确保服务器具有足够的内存与存储空间,以容纳构建后的静态资源及可能扩展的应用需求。
  • 优先考虑开通安全组规则,限制不必要的端口开放,保障网络安全。

部署流程详解

以下是部署 Vue 项目至阿里云服务器的具体操作步骤:

  1. 通过 SSH 工具连接到阿里云服务器,执行必要的更新与升级命令。
  2. 上传构建好的 Vue 项目文件至服务器指定目录,可以采用 FTP 或 SCP 方法进行传输。
  3. 在服务器上安装必要的依赖包,包括但不限于 Node.js 和 Nginx。
  4. 配置 Nginx 以反向代理方式处理前端请求,确保客户端能够正确访问应用。
  5. 设置定时任务或监控工具,定期检查服务状态并及时响应异常情况。

优化与维护

完成初步部署后,还需持续关注系统的性能表现并实施优化措施:

  • 启用 HTTPS 加密协议,保护数据传输的安全性。
  • 定期清理无用文件和日志记录,释放磁盘空间。
  • 利用阿里云提供的弹性伸缩功能,动态调整资源分配以应对流量高峰。
  • 结合阿里云监控平台,实时掌握服务器运行状况。

总结

将 Vue 项目部署到阿里云服务器是一项技术性较强的工作,需要开发者具备扎实的基础知识与实践经验。通过遵循上述指南,您可以顺利完成部署过程,并为用户提供流畅稳定的使用体验。未来,持续学习新技术并灵活运用各种工具将是提升部署效率的关键所在。

未经允许不得转载:一万网络 » 在阿里云服务器上搭建Vue项目